Understanding Renters Insurance and How It Works
Renters insurance provides essential protection for individuals and families who lease their homes, apartments, or other residential properties. Unlike homeowners insurance, renters insurance covers the personal belongings of tenants, liability protection in case of accidents or injuries on the property, and additional living expenses if the rental becomes uninhabitable due to a covered event. In College Corner (Preble portion), Ohio, renters insurance is a practical safeguard for residents who want to protect their possessions and financial well-being without the responsibility of property ownership.
This type of coverage typically includes personal property protection, which reimburses you for losses due to theft, fire, or certain natural disasters. Liability coverage protects you if someone is injured while visiting your rental home or if you accidentally cause damage to others’ property. Additional living expenses coverage helps cover temporary housing costs if your rental unit becomes unlivable due to a covered peril. Understanding these core components is vital for renters in the 45064 ZIP code to ensure they have the right protection tailored to their needs.

ZIP Code 45064 Risk Factors and Typical Renters Insurance Claims
Renters in the 45064 ZIP code face several risk factors that influence the types of claims commonly filed in this area. One significant consideration is the weather pattern influenced by the Indiana-Ohio border, where College Corner is situated. Winters here tend to be cold, with occasional snow and ice storms that can lead to water damage from frozen pipes or roof leaks. Storms crossing the region can also cause power outages and property damage, making coverage for weather-related incidents a critical component of renters insurance policies.
Another factor is the rural-suburban mix of the area. While crime rates in College Corner (Preble portion) and Israel Township are generally lower than in urban centers, theft and vandalism still occur, particularly in more isolated locations. Renters insurance claims often include stolen personal property, such as electronics, bicycles, and tools. Liability claims may arise from slip-and-fall accidents on icy sidewalks or driveways, especially during the winter months. Understanding these common claim patterns helps renters in 45064 anticipate their coverage needs and work with insurers to mitigate potential gaps.
How Renters Insurance Pricing is Determined in 45064
Insurance carriers consider several factors when pricing renters insurance policies in College Corner (Preble portion) and the broader 45064 ZIP code. The rural-suburban character of the area generally results in moderate pricing compared to urban centers, but specific local risks can influence premiums. For example, the presence of older rental properties may lead insurers to assess higher risk for water damage or fire, which can affect rates. Weather-related risks, such as winter storms and their potential for property damage, also play a role in pricing considerations.
Proximity to major roads like US-27 can be a factor in pricing, as easier access to emergency services and lower crime rates along well-traveled corridors may reduce risk. Conversely, more remote areas within Israel Township might see slightly higher premiums due to longer emergency response times. Insurance carriers also evaluate the renter’s coverage limits, deductible choices, and any additional endorsements or riders selected to tailor protection.
